On Saturday, March, the Drumline competed at Del Norte High School against eight other groups, taking 4th place with a score of 68.28. This is the first competition of the season
The drumline received a "timing penalty" for not having a long enough show ( it is common for this to occur early on in the season). The drumline is starting off the season well with a score like this. The music is well composed by the drumline instructor Terrance Norris, and there are cool visual effects and drill included in the show.
The Drumline's next show is at Mission Vista High School on March 29.
